    I fear that during the debate, Keyes will resort to typical talk-show / television interview tactics. That is, even if Obama is making a really great point, Keyes will attack a single word in the explanation and not the explanation itself. Or, if pinched into a corner, he will attempt to turn the tide by attacking Obama personally.

    It's the common practice that if you can't argue against the facts, argue against the person. It's the same attitude used when OJ's defense team couldn't defend the evidence so they attacked the police department. Discredit the person enough and nothing they say will hold credit.
